Synopsis
What is excellence? And how can women cultivate it amidst the hustle and bustle of daily life? That's what Navigator author and Bible teacher Cynthia Heald desired to find out after reading the beautiful description on Ruth voiced by Boaz: "All my people in the city know that you are a woman of excellence" (3:11, NASB).
In this warm and personal booklet, Cynthia outlines the qualities that characterize a woman of excellence—things like strength, virtue, courage, capability, and wisdom—and she goes on to explain how you can develop those same traits in your own life.
About the Author
EUGENE H. PETERSON is a writer poet and retired pastor. He has authored more than thirty-four books (not including The Message ). He is Professor Emeritus of Spiritual Theology at Regent College in Vancouver British Columbia. Eugene also founded Christ Our King Presbyterian Church in Bel Air Maryland where he ministered for twenty-nine years. He lives with his wife Jan in Montana.
